Oil Assessments
OFTEC assessments are taken under the same strict rules as the gas assessments. Centres able to carry out OFTEC assessments must be approved by accredited Certification Bodies. The Certification Bodies are accredited to the requirements of BS EN ISO/IEC 17024: 2003 via UKAS (United Kingdom Accreditation Service).

Domestic/light Commercial Pressure Jet Appliance Commissioning and Servicing
Covers the regulations and standards required that apply to Pressure Jet Appliances 
Training Objectives:
  • Safety
  • Fuel feed pipework
  • Boiler Commissioning
  • Building Regulations
  • Types of Burners
  • Insulation
Domestic Oil Firing Installation and Energy Conservation Measures in Buildings
Covers the regulations and standards that apply to installation practice
Training Objectives
  • Oil storage (less than 3500 litres)
  • Fuel feed pipework
  • Safety requirements
  • Flueing and ventilation
  • Heating system design L1
Domestic and Non-domestic Oil Storage and SupplyInstallation
Covers the maintanence and installation of oil storage tanks in the domestic and light commercial sector
Training Objectives
  • Safety requirements
  • Tank fittings
  • Fuel feed pipework
  • Types of oil
  • System design
  • Oil storage (more than 3500 litres)
  • Contamination
